Scaling Your Business for Exponential Growth
To reach exponential growth, your business needs to expand strategically. This involves pinpointing high-impact areas where you can leverage resources and implement processes that optimize efficiency.

A well-defined plan is crucial for directing your growth efforts. This should include clear goals, a timeline, and measurable metrics to assess your performance.
Don't be afraid to trial different methods and adjust your strategy based on outcomes. Remember, scaling a business is an ongoing journey that requires continuous refinement.

Funding Your Dreams: Investment Options for Startups
Turning your aspiration into a thriving company requires capital. Fortunately, there are a myriad of capitalization options available to startups like yours.
Early-stage funding often comes from mentors who believe in your idea. They provide essential initial investment to get your venture off the ground. As you grow, you can explore Series A rounds, which involve larger firms seeking a stake in your growing business.
Crowdfunding has also emerged as a popular approach for startups to raise funds from a wider pool of backers.
Don't be afraid to investigate these various options and find the perfect fit for your unique venture.
